Answering “Why” to Prevent Recurrence

When a critical material, component, or structure fails, immediate repairs are only a short-term solution. The key to long-term reliability lies in understanding why it failed. Failure Analysis investigates the physical cause—such as fatigue, corrosion, or overload—while Root Cause Investigation uncovers the deeper systemic or procedural issues that led to the failure.

Key Investigation Activities

Physical Failure Analysis (Laboratory-Based)

Using techniques such as scanning electron microscopy (SEM), metallography, chemical analysis, and hardness testing, BQCIS identifies the physical failure mode—whether fatigue, brittle fracture, or stress corrosion cracking. This forms the technical foundation of every investigation.

Root Cause Investigation & Data Review

Our structured approach (5-Why, Fishbone, or Fault Tree Analysis) examines design, operation, maintenance, and human factors. We correlate laboratory findings with procedural data to identify not only the failure’s physical cause but the organizational root cause behind it.

Success Story

Failure Analysis of Welded Joint Prevents Structural Collapse

The Challenge:

A structural steel truss in a logistics facility failed at a weld joint during commissioning. The client required immediate root cause analysis to assess safety implications and liability exposure.

Our Solution:

BQCIS collected the failed section and performed detailed metallographic and SEM fracture analysis. Findings revealed hydrogen-induced cracking due to moisture-contaminated consumables and inadequate preheating.

The Result:

The investigation enabled rapid procedural correction and inspection of identical joints across the site, preventing further failure. The client also implemented a new consumable control system and revised WPS to ensure permanent corrective action.
